Good Teams, Bad Teams in the Age of AI

This week ran as a set: Part I named the activity trap, Part II showed why fixes ripple sideways, and Part III turns to the humans inside the system — drawing on Steven Thurber and Bryan Miller’s Good Team, Bad Team (Page Two, 2024).

The core reframe: as AI agents join the team, human team quality matters more, not less — technology amplifies whatever dynamic already exists. An agent doesn’t fix a bad team; it gives one a faster way to be wrong together. Deloitte found 56% of leaders design AI for business outcomes but only 40% for both business and human outcomes. Thurber and Miller’s distinctions translate directly: good teams create psychological safety to challenge AI recommendations and hold a shared definition of winning; bad teams suppress dissent and drift into activity without alignment. The difference is rarely expertise — it’s whether disagreement surfaces before deployment or only after an incident. One plant’s challenge protocols caught edge cases on a whiteboard; another found the same ones on the production line.

Building the good version is deliberate: select for collaborative capacity, define decision rights, reward challenge of humans and AI, invest in facilitation, review team effectiveness like technical performance.
